The number of mortgage approvals by the main high street banks in July fell by 0.8 per cent compared to the same month a year earlier. Within this, remortgaging approvals were 2.8 per cent higher than for the same period a year earlier. There was a fall in house purchase and other secured borrowing of 0.6 per cent and 11.7 per cent respectively.
Credit card spending was 8.1 per cent higher than a year earlier, with outstanding levels on card borrowing growing by 5.3 per cent over the year. Outstanding overdraft borrowing was 4 per cent lower compared to the same time last year.
Personal deposits grew by 1.2 per cent in the last 12 months. Deposits held in instant access accounts were 3.8 per cent higher than a year earlier.
